Insurance premiums on a Mercury Mountaineer will vary greatly subject to many criteria. Taken into consideration are:

  • Your driving record
  • Your credit history
  • Big city or small town
  • The number of annual miles
  • Your sex
  • Higher deductibles save money
  • NTSB crash rating for your vehicle
  • What you do for a living
  • The amount of protection requested
  • Owning a home can lower rates
